Ericksonian Clinical Hypnosis:
Unlike the often scary depiction of hypnosis on TV, in the movies and at those stage shows where people do embarrassing things like quack like a duck, Clinical Hypnosis is used by Doctors, Dentists, Therapists, and Peak Performance Coaches like myself to help people change.

People don't realize that we spend a good portion of every single day drifting in and out of trance. Have you ever driven down the highway and "spaced out?" Ever miss your exit because you were "somewhere else?" Almost everyone has! But while you were "somewhere else" who was driving your car?!?! Your Unconscious Mind.

Through clinical hypnosis you learn how to communicate with your unconscious mind so that you get the results you want rather than what you've been mistakenly asking for.

For example, if you consistently see yourself as fat and tell yourself so and beat yourself up for being fat, your unconscious mind gets all these images of you as fat and goes about giving you what you've inadvertently told it you want.

With the proper use of hypnosis we change those kinds of messages and ask for what we truly want in the correct way that your unconscious mind needs to hear it.

The result is permanent, positive change. Sometimes it happens so easily as to feel miraculous. It's actually based on sound science but without the dangerous side effects of drugs or invasive operations.
